Thomas Hobbes's seminal work, *Leviathan*, published in 1651, is a cornerstone of political philosophy that explores the foundations of civilization and the structure of society. Written during the tumultuous period of the English Civil War, Hobbes employs a distinctively clear and methodical literary style, combining rigorous logical argumentation with vivid metaphor.
